Time to get the clippers out
Now’s a good time to get the clippers out and prune back any branches or vegetation overhanging the footpaths from your property.
This is required to keep footpaths safe and accessible for everyone, be it the postie, someone with a guide dog or a push chair.
If you rent the property, check with the property manager or owner on who is responsible.
Footpath and overhanging vegetation inspections take place in April and May, so your early attention may save you being issued a reminder notice.
Thanks for looking after our footpath users and keeping Marlborough safe, tidy and accessible.
